Solution of the Stokes problem with parameter by the use of iteration of boundary conditions

An iterative method for solving the Stokes problem with parameter in a rectangular domain is proposed and
substantiated. The convergence rate of the method does not depend on the parameter and on the ratio of the rectangle sides. Some numerical results are discussed for a test problem on a cavern.
